SW19 1AA is a safe, established residential area on Cowper Road, 0.4km from Wimbledon, South in Merton. Administratively it sits within Wandle ward and the Wimbledon constituency.

Day-to-day life in SW19 1AA has the character of a significant portion of adults hold a degree, but a notable number have also pursued apprenticeships in the past. employment is predominantly concentrated in caring, leisure and other service occupations, or in sales and customer services. individuals in this subgroup are slightly more likely to be uk-born, compared with the group average. the population displays a fairly balanced age distribution, apart from the smaller proportion of elderly retirees. the neighbourhoods show limited ethnic diversity, and the housing landscape primarily consists of terraced homes, with a mix of detached and semi-detached properties as well. it is not uncommon for residents to own multiple vehicles. The daytime character shifts — higher status cosmopolitan professional services and self-employment. The 36 average age reflects a mixed, mid-career community — settling down but not yet slowing down. Employment levels are high (58% in full-time work) — a well-connected, economically active community.

Safety: Crime rates are low here at 31 incidents per 1,000 residents — well below average and reassuring for families. Property: Prices average £478k, up 7.5% year-on-year.

Census 2021 statistics for SW19 1AA are sourced from Output Area E00017484 (shared with 5 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
